Barchester Healthcare is the market leader in providing quality residential and nursing care. We are looking for an experienced Regional Personal Assistant to support a thriving division. Working remotely from home/partly based in one of our homes dependent on location; you will be relied upon to provide invaluable administrative and diary support to the Directors. As the only healthcare provider to be accredited as one of the best companies to work for in the UK, Barchester are dedicated to ensuring that our team are respected and their contribution valued.
NEED TO HAVE
- Previous experience as a PA (desirable)
- Excellent communications skills (written and verbal) and feels at ease with senior members of management
- Strong attention to detail
- Excellent organisation skills and able to prioritise
- Ability to deal with large amounts of confidential information
NEED TO KNOW
- Good knowledge of Microsoft Office and Outlook Email & Calendars
- Diary and inbox management
NEED TO DO
- Timely and accurate diary and meeting management
- Collate weekly data for KPI reports
- Attending meetings and take minutes as required
- Book travel and accommodation for regional team members
- Manage and flag urgent emails
- Keep accurate annual leave records for General Managers of the homes your Directors cover
- Assist in the organisation of two Quality First Conferences per year
- Be a point of contact for the Divisional Executive Assistant during periods of annual leave, working in conjunction with the other Regional PA for the division
